    After the sun sets, the Japanese moon landers gets back to work

    The Japan Aerospace Exploration Agency (JAXA) re-established contact with its ‘Smart Lander’ for Investigating Moon (SLIM) on Tuesday, a day after it touched down near the Moon’s equator. “Communication with SLIM was successfully established last night, and operations resumed,” JAXA said.
